命名習慣
類型 | 要求 | 實例 |
---|---|---|
包 | 全小寫 | com.team5101.*; |
類 | 首字母大寫 | Demo01 |
方法 | 單詞小寫(1),多個單詞,第一個小寫,其餘首字母大寫(小駝峯命名法) | setAge |
變量 | 同上[小駝峯命名法] | myName |
常量 | 全部大寫,多個單詞下劃線鏈接 | MY_COUNTRY |
區分邏輯運算符 ‘&’ 與‘&&’ 和 ‘|’ 與 ‘||’
- ‘&’ 與‘&&’的區別
運算符 | 實例 | 說明 |
---|---|---|
& (與) | A&B&C&D | A->D運行,最後得出Boolean值 |
&&(短路與) | A&&B&&C&&D | /A->D運行,只要遇到false,直接跳出,整個表達式的結果就是false |
- ‘&’ 與‘&&’的區別
運算符 | 實例 | 說明 |
---|---|---|
| (或) | A|B|C|D | A->D運行,最後得出Boolean值 |
||(短路或) | A||B||C||D | A->D運行,只要遇到true,直接跳出,整個表達式的結果就是true |
功能性註釋
- 功能性註釋嵌在源程序中,用於說明程序段或語句的功能以及數據的狀態
- 修改程序也應修改註釋
- 可使用空行或縮進,以便很容易區分註釋和程序
待續~